人気ブログランキング | 話題のタグを見る

「わかりました」>「あんまりわかってません」の間接的な用法


by ayamem
カレンダー
S M T W T F S
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31

OREPPIXの作り方

KNOPPIXカスタマイズの仕方。



/dev/hda1 ... 4GB-->ext3
/dev/hda2 ... 1GB-->linux-swap
を用意してKNOPPIXをbootしてrootで以下を実行
mke2fs -j /dev/hda1
mount -t ext3 /dev/hda1 /mnt/hda1
mkdir -p /mnt/hda1/src
mkdir -p /mnt/hda1/dst
cp -Rp /KNOPPIX/* /mnt/hda1/src/.
cp -Rp /cdrom/* /mnt/hda1/dst/.
mv /mnt/hda1/dst/etc/dhcpc/resolv.conf /mnt/hda1/dst/etc/dhcpc/resolv.conf.old
cp /etc/dhcpc/resolv.conf /mnt/hda1/src/etc/dhcpc/.
##ここでKNOPPIXに入れておきたいファイルを/mnt/src/~にコピーしておく##
chroot /mnt/hda1/src/
mount -t proc /proc proc
apt-get update
apt-get install ~ ##ここで追加したいパッケージをネットワークインストール##
apt-get clean
rm /etc/dhcpc/resolv.conf
mv /etc/dhcpc/resolv.conf.old /etc/dhcpc/resolv.conf
rm -rf /var/log/*.*
rm -rf /var/tmp/*.*
rm -rf /root/*.*
updatedb
umount /proc
exit
mkisofs -R -l -V "OREPPIX filesystem" -hide-rr-moved /mnt/hda1/src | create_compressed_fs - 65536 > /mnt/hda1/dst/KNOPPIX/KNOPPIX
cd /mnt/hda1/dst
mkisofs -l -r -v "OREPPIX" -b boot/isolinux/isolinux.bin -c boot/isolinux/boot.cat -o /mnt/hda1/oreppix.iso -no-emul-boot -boot-load-size 4 -boot-info-table /mnt/hda1/dst
これで/mnt/hda1/oreppix.isoをcdに焼けば出来上がり
by ayamem | 2004-09-23 18:08